PilotLoops – Circular aquaculture South Baltic pilots

  • To develop and promote new circular solutions in aquaculture through 3 cross-border pilots concentrated on testing, demonstration, and communication of the circular approach in innovative aquaculture production methods, with the aim to lead to the reduction of waste and water use/loss, production of valuable byproducts, in order to preserve natural resources and reduce environmental impacts.
  • Through testing, carrying out in depth analysis, and cooperation with project associated partners, through a link with accurate commercial technology of associated partners, with prompt exchange of data and technology solutions to test interactively from the lab scale to the farm scale.
  • Providing jointly developed protocols for further applications by enterprises and substantial input to the training, and support activities of the project.

Activities

  • Development of three cross-border physical pilots
  • Testing for results delivery
  • Pilots demonstrations
  • Pilots results delivery and communication

Deliverables

  • TARAS – AquaLoop Gdańsk (PL) protocol development and delivery
  • NEMATIC – AquaLoop Rostock (DE) protocol development and delivery
  • FISHVISAAquaLoop Klaipeda (LT) protocol development and delivery

TrainingLoop – Circular aquaculture training pool

  • To prepare different generations of stakeholders: school kids, students and young professionals for the circular approach in economy in general and aquaculture production and consumption specifically, in order to boost their career opportunities, taking under consideration ecological and economic progress of the region at the same time.
  • Based on the state-of-the-art findings of the INTERREG projects, in terms of careers development in the sector of blue bioeconomy, circular economy and nutrition, high training competencies of the consortium, and high standard of the facilities: FishGlassHouse (DE), University of Gdańsk RAS facilities (PL), Fisheries and Aquaculture Laboratory with modern RAS (LT), and highly developed network of partners: SMEs, universities, municipalities,  and sectoral associations.
  • Providing jointly developed curricula and manuals for study programs for school kids, students, and young professionals and cross-border trainings and awareness raising activities.

Activities

  • Development and implementation of training programme for secondary school youth
  • Development and implementation of training programme for students
  • Development of training programme, facility definition and implementation for professionals
  • TrainingLoop communication and dissemination

Deliverables

  • TrainingLoop programme for secondary school youth development and delivery
  • TrainingLoop programme for students’ development and delivery
  • TrainingLoop programme for professionals’ development and delivery

SupportLoop – Circular aquaculture stakeholder support

  • To show interested stakeholders the potentials and challenges of establishing a land-based RAS aquaculture production on an existing agricultural farm, also with the aim of supporting reduction of nutrient impacts in existing SB sea-cage production.
  • By documenting the economic and environmental frameworks required across the SB region, as well as facilitating workshops with stakeholder groups, study visits to existing commercial and pilot units.
  • Providing tools for stakeholder support: professionals, SMEs, associations, and authorities including recommendations and protocols from the project through AquaLoop: Aquaculture expert floor for circular economy practice platform and international AquaLoop Conference.

Activities

  • SupportLoop assessments
  • SupportLoop study visits and workshops
  • AquaLoop platform and conference

Deliverables

  • Feasibility and economic assessment development and delivery
  • Circular aquaculture comparative study development and delivery
  • AquaLoop: Aquaculture expert floor for circular economy practice platform delivery
